Top Platforms for Premiering Music Videos
- YouTube: The most popular video platform worldwide, offering extensive reach and monetization options. Its premiere feature allows artists to debut videos with a live chat, creating an engaging experience for fans.
- Vimeo: Known for high-quality video hosting, Vimeo is ideal for artists seeking a more professional presentation. Its privacy controls and customization options make it a favorite among independent creators.
- Facebook: With its massive user base, Facebook allows artists to premiere videos directly to their followers, fostering immediate interaction and sharing.
Best Platforms for Distributing Music Videos
- Spotify: While primarily an audio platform, Spotify also supports music videos through its video features, providing exposure to millions of listeners.
- Apple Music: Offers a dedicated space for music videos, allowing artists to reach a premium audience with high-quality content.
- Instagram: With IGTV and Reels, Instagram is perfect for short-form music videos and engaging visual content to connect with fans.
- TikTok: Known for viral videos, TikTok enables artists to distribute snippets of their music videos to a broad audience and generate buzz.
Choosing the Right Platform
When selecting a platform, consider your target audience, the type of content, and your promotional goals. Combining multiple platforms often yields the best results, allowing you to maximize visibility and engagement across different viewer segments.
